Diameter: 1/8" (3mm) Colors: Black, Blue, Green, Orange, Red, Silver, and Yellow. WebOct 4, 2024 · After the leader shouts a knot, scouts race to a rope 10 feet away. After the leader approves the knot, the scout unties the knot and races back to tag the next scout in line, who repeats the action. The first team to finish wins. Each round should feature a different knot type. Speed Games. Scouts test their knot-tying speed in these games.
